Document the critical-action property to describe the thermal
action that will be taken after the critical temperature is reached.
The possible values are:
- 0 for shutdown
- 1 for reboot.

Introduce hw_protection_reboot() to trigger an emergency reboot.
It is a counterpart of hw_protection_shutdown() with the difference
that it will force a reboot instead of shutdown.
The motivation for doing this is to allow the thermal subystem
to trigger a reboot when the temperature reaches the critical
temperature.

+/**
+ * hw_protection_reboot - Trigger an emergency system reboot
+ *
+ * @reason: Reason of emergency reboot to be printed.
+ * @ms_until_forced: Time to wait for orderly reboot before tiggering a
+ * forced reboot. Negative value disables the forced
+ * reboot.
+ *
+ * Initiate an emergency system reboot in order to protect hardware from
+ * further damage. Usage examples include a thermal protection.
+ *
+ * NOTE: The request is ignored if protection reboot is already pending even
+ * if the previous request has given a large timeout for forced reboot.
+ * Can be called from any context.
+ */
+void hw_protection_reboot(const char *reason, int ms_until_forced)
+{
+ static atomic_t allow_proceed = ATOMIC_INIT(1);
+
+ pr_emerg("HARDWARE PROTECTION reboot (%s)\n", reason);
+
+ /* Reboot should be initiated only once. */
+ if (!atomic_dec_and_test(&allow_proceed))
+ return;
+
+ /*
+ * Queue a backup emergency reboot in the event of
+ * orderly_reboot failure
+ */
+ hw_failure_emergency_poweroff(ms_until_forced);
+ orderly_reboot();
+}
+EXPORT_SYMBOL_GPL(hw_protection_reboot);

Currently, the default mechanism is to trigger a shutdown after the
critical temperature is reached.
In some embedded cases, such behavior does not suit well, as the board may
be unattended in the field and rebooting may be a better approach.
The bootloader may also check the temperature and only allow the boot to
proceed when the temperature is below a certain threshold.
Introduce support for allowing a reboot to be triggered after the
critical temperature is reached.
If the "critical-action" devicetree property is not found, fall back to
the shutdown action to preserve the existing default behavior.
Tested on a i.MX8MM board with the following devicetre changes:
thermal-zones {
cpu-thermal {
critical-action = <THERMAL_CRITICAL_ACTION_REBOOT>;
};
};
